ايمه aima A. s. m. (for aʼịmma, plur. of امام but used to denote) Land given as a reward or fa- vour by the king at a very low rent, a fief. (When no rent is paid, the land is called لااخراج lā ḵẖirāj). Charity lands. ايمه دار aima-dār, One who holds land in ايمه aima, a feoffee.
